RFID with SAP (Scenario –I)

RFID Label document

Typically a LAN Based RFID Reader is connected to LAN to scan the RFID Labels on items / FG. This allows the faster and accurate data entry into ERP

database with the help of Middleware application on real

time data sharing basis.

SAP GUI

RFID & SAP (Scenario-II)

SAP

RFID Tagged goods

Using Mobile computers allows the direct scanning of RFID on products and update the

transactions through flat files.

•Allows limited validations on data

•Stores the data on hand held memory

•Needs a PC for communication with SAP

Text files SAP GUI

RFID& SAP (Scenario-III)

SAP

RFID Tagged goods

Using RF system allows online transaction with SAP system directly from hand held computers using a middleware software communicating with SAP using RFC/BAPI

interface

Online

RFC/BAPI

Middleware

Government Resolution:

OEMs to fit RFID tags on Passenger cars and commercial vehicles (M & N Category)

Gazette was published on April 8th, 2013 and will be effective from October 6th, 2013.

Reference to Gazette published by MORT&H during October, 2012 and previously Sep, 2011

Tags suppliers will have to obtain the Compliance Approval from third party /agency

Automotive Research Association of India (ARAI) has been nominated to test and approve the tags

Issued by Ministry of Road Transportation & Highways

RFID data Security in AVI Application GENERAL OVERVIEW – IN COLLABORATION TO EXITING RFID SETUP AT VARIOUS TOLL POINTS AND BACK END SYSTEM

Risks involved with Electronic Identity:

Security is a common concern in many applications

The security risks faced by users of RFID include business risks such as: ◦ Cloning

◦ Counterfeiting

◦ Skimming license numbers, vehicle identification numbers, or other personally identifiable information off from the tags*

A security breach could cost millions in terms of Brand and Leakage of revenue with in the system.

- Guidelines for Securing Radio Frequency Identification (RFID) Systems, National Institute of Standards and Technology (NIST), Special Publication 800-98, April 2007

- Construction of the Enterprise-level RFID Security and Privacy Management Using Role-Based Key Management”, Systems, Man and Cybernetics, 2006, IEEE International
